Beginning Of Menopause Known As Perimenopause
0
SHARES
17
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Women naturally transition from their reproductive years to the period where their menstruation starts to change. This transition is perimenopause, and it usually begins in around 40s and ends when menopause begins, which is around 50s. There isn’t a certain age for how long perimenopause will last, but that can be from one year to 10 years.

What is happening during perimenopause?

Hormones are changing their levels, and the results are different changes such as night sweats, hot flushes, sleep disturbances, heavy menstrual bleeding, vaginal changes, memory changes, urinary changes, and lower sex desire.

For some women, perimenopause is an easy period, but for many others, the perimenopause symptoms create a range of discomforts. Because hormones fluctuate unpredictably, lower estrogen and declining progesterone can cause migraines, weight gain, nausea, sore breasts, night sweats, sleep problems. For this group of women, perimenopause can be troublesome physically and emotionally.

Perimenopause symptoms

The first sign of perimenopause will be an abnormality in the menstrual circle. Commonly, women experience very heavy bleeding where large pads or tampons cannot contain it. This brings women at risk of anemia. If you notice these changes, contact your doctor as he can improve your iron levels. The doctor will most probably include therapy to reduce bleeding.

Hot flushes and night sweats are well-known signs of perimenopause, and for some women, they can continue even after menopause. Interestingly, 20 to 30% of women never have them. When women are experiencing a hot flash, she will suddenly feel the heat in her upper body and then in a whole body, which will cause sweating, and sometimes cold chill afterward.

Sleep changes appear for most women in menopause. Night sweats will most probably be the cause for waking up, and women will have a problem to fall asleep again. Some women have a problem to fall asleep when they go to bed, so for every woman is different.

Vaginal changes are infallible perimenopause sign. As estrogen and progesterone levels decline, vaginal tissue becomes less flexible, drier, and vaginal walls become thinner. This tissue becomes more prone to cracks, so women experience pain and irritation during penetration.
